Ovulation Day = LMP + (CL − 14) Fertile Window Start = Ovulation Day − 5 Fertile Window End = Ovulation Day EDD (Naegele's Rule) = LMP + 280 days
Ovulation typically occurs approximately 14 days before the start of your next expected period. Because cycle length varies among women, the ovulation day is calculated by subtracting 14 from your average cycle length, then adding that number of days to the first day of your last menstrual period (LMP).
The fertile window spans the 5 days before ovulation plus the day of ovulation itself (6 days total), because sperm can survive up to 5 days in the reproductive tract.
If conception occurs on the estimated ovulation day, the estimated due date (EDD) is calculated using Naegele's Rule: add 280 days (40 weeks) to the LMP date.
Ovulation Day = June 1 + (30 − 14) = June 1 + 16 = **June 17, 2025** Fertile Window Start = June 17 − 5 = **June 12, 2025** Fertile Window End = **June 17, 2025** EDD = June 1 + 280 days = **March 8, 2026**
Result: Ovulation Day: June 17, 2025 | Fertile Window: June 12–17, 2025 | Estimated Due Date (if conceived): March 8, 2026
In this example, a woman with a 30-day cycle whose last period began on June 1, 2025 would be most fertile between June 12 and June 17, with ovulation most likely on June 17. If she conceives during this window, her estimated due date would be around March 8, 2026. Keep in mind that ovulation timing can shift by several days due to stress, illness, or hormonal fluctuations, so these are estimates, not guarantees. Confirm ovulation with an LH surge test (OPK) or basal body temperature (BBT) tracking for greater accuracy.

The luteal phase (from ovulation to next period) is relatively fixed at approximately 14 days in most women, which is why the formula subtracts 14 from the cycle length. Women with shorter cycles (e.g., 24 days) ovulate around Day 10; women with longer cycles (e.g., 35 days) ovulate around Day 21.
An egg survives only 12–24 hours after ovulation. However, sperm can live inside the fallopian tubes for up to 5 days. This creates a 6-day window of fertility: the 5 days before ovulation plus the day of ovulation itself. Studies show the highest probability of conception occurs when intercourse takes place 1–2 days before ovulation.
Naegele's Rule, published in the 19th century, adds 280 days (40 weeks) to the LMP to estimate the due date. It assumes ovulation on Day 14 and a 28-day cycle; adjustments may be needed for longer or shorter cycles. Ultrasound dating (especially an 8–12 week scan) typically provides a more precise EDD.

Cycle irregularities, polycystic ovary syndrome (PCOS), thyroid disorders, and other factors can significantly affect ovulation timing. Start testing with an OPK about 2 days before the estimated ovulation day shown by the calculator. For a predicted ovulation on Day 17 of your cycle, begin testing on Day 15. Test at the same time each day (mid-morning is generally recommended), avoiding first morning urine.
Implantation typically occurs 6–12 days after fertilization. A home pregnancy test is most reliable from the first day of your missed period, which is approximately 14 days after the estimated ovulation day. Testing too early can produce a false negative.
Polycystic ovary syndrome (PCOS) often causes anovulatory cycles (cycles where no egg is released) or highly irregular cycles, making calendar-based predictions unreliable. Women with PCOS should work with a gynecologist and may benefit from medically supervised cycle tracking or fertility treatment.
Breastfeeding can suppress ovulation through elevated prolactin levels (lactational amenorrhea), so the calculator's formula — which relies on regular menstrual cycles — is not applicable during exclusive breastfeeding. Cycles can resume unpredictably once breastfeeding frequency decreases.
For a typical 28-day cycle, ovulation occurs around Day 14, which is 14 days after the first day of your period. For other cycle lengths, subtract 14 from your cycle length to get the approximate day of ovulation (e.g., for a 32-day cycle, ovulation is around Day 18).
An ovulation calculator is a reasonable first estimate for women with regular cycles, but it can be off by 2–4 days. Actual ovulation can shift due to stress, illness, travel, or hormonal changes. For greater accuracy, pair calculator results with OPK testing or BBT charting.
You can enter your best estimated average cycle length, but results will be less reliable. Women with cycles that vary by more than 7 days month to month are advised to use OPKs, which directly detect the LH surge regardless of cycle length.
Enter the average number of days between the first day of two consecutive periods. For best accuracy, average 3–6 recent cycles. If your cycles have been 27, 29, and 28 days, enter 28.
It uses the same Naegele's Rule formula your OB-GYN typically uses at the first visit. However, doctors commonly adjust the EDD after an early ultrasound (8–12 weeks), which is more precise. Treat the calculator's EDD as a preliminary estimate.

Not always. Even women with regular cycles can experience occasional early or late ovulation due to factors like stress, travel across time zones, illness, or dietary changes. That's why real-time tracking methods like OPKs add valuable confirmation.
